Ka Vee Amish School in Belleville, PA, serves 34 students in grades 1 through 9 within a rural community setting.
Founded in 1945, this co–educational school follows an Amish orientation with a religious affiliation categorized as other religious.
The school operates with one teacher, resulting in a student–teacher ratio of 34:1.
Nearby schools within 2.5 miles include other Amish and Christian–oriented institutions serving similar grade spans and student populations.
